    Main Areas of Responsibility

    Your responsibilities will include:
    Ensuring an orderly and calm environment at all times in student services
    Providing relevant information to students at student services reception
    Ensuring that student information is accurately updated and maintained in BROMCOM for new admissions
    Coordinating admissions to the academy, including In Year Admissions, and being the link between the Local Authority and academy admissions procedure and policy
    Reporting all CME and PMOE to local authority in line with statutory guidance
    Coordinating the academy uniform supplier for new intake evenings and managing uniform stock held by the academy
    Maintaining student files in line with guidance, including safe storage and archiving
    Ensuring all student files are sent safely and fully tracked to transferring schools
    Managing off-rolling and ensuring that files are maintained in line with guidance
    Ensuring that a PEEP assessment is carried out for all students who present themselves at student services requiring one
    Coordinating and distributing daily detention information
    Coordinating exclusion and suspension paperwork, as required by the Principal's PA
    Liaising with parents when requested to do so, including via SMS and letter
    Supporting academy events such as induction days
    Supporting, where required, with home visits
    Maintaining a first aid qualification and delivering first aid support
